If you need to make mass quantities of Christmas cards, like I do, your Sizzix Big Shot can be a big helper. In the current Stampin' Up! Holiday Mini, they have this big Sizzix Scallop Circle Bigz Die. It was love at first sight for me. You will see me use this quite often I'm sure!

I used the scallop circle die to make a bunch of these Christmas cards. I cut out one scallop circle and cut it in half to get two cards done at a time. Then I used my circle Nestabilities to cut out a circle to stamp my holiday sentiment on and layer on top the scallop.

My Christmas paper stash is out of control. Can you relate? I have like 15 sheets of this beautiful holly paper by Anna Griffin. All I did was layer it on a couple pieces of Stampin' Up! cardstock and stuck my circles underneath it. I covered up the seams with cream colored ric-rac and attached a Making Memories poinsettia. I am so excited because there is some exciting news with Stampin' Up! They have teamed up with Sizzix to offer the Big Shot machine along with dies that will only be sold exclusively through Stampin' Up! I saw a sneak peek of these dies, and they are cool.

So what does this little machine do? The Big Shot is a sturdy manual die cutting machine used to die cut materials for use on crafts, home décor projects, and even clothing--it's a big deal! The Big Shot is a 6-time winner of Creating Keepsakes Reader's Choice Award for best die cutting equipment and dies. Another good point to make it the Big Shot works with ALL competitive dies, embossing folders, and Nestabilities. The steel rule dies can cut through an impressive list of 50 different materials, including fabric, foil, and chipboard.
